Description

Operation Market Garden is a "double-blind" game focusing on the failed Allied airborne offensive of September 1944. It was one of three "double-blind" land warfare wargames released by GDW in the eighties. The game system used two maps so that both players were "in the dark" as to the disposition of the opposing forces at the start of the game. The game system does not require a referee, but instead relies on the honor system.

Operation Market Garden is in the same series with The Normandy Campaign and 8th Army: Operation Crusader – The Winter Battles for Tobruk, 1941, and was republished in #115 of Command magazine Japan in 2014.
